ribose 1,5-bisphosphate phosphokinase

Cat No.
EXWM-3205
Description
This enzyme, found in NAD supression mutants of Escherichia coli, synthesizes 5-phospho-α-D-ribose 1-diphosphate (PRPP) without the participation of EC 2.7.6.1, ribose-phosphate diphosphokinase. Ribose, ribose 1-phosphate and ribose 5-phosphate are not substrates, and GTP cannot act as a phosphate donor.

Synonyms
ribose 1,5-bisphosphokinase; PhnN; ATP:ribose-1,5-bisphosphate phosphotransferase
Reaction
ATP + α-D-ribose 1,5-bisphosphate = ADP + 5-phospho-α-D-ribose 1-diphosphate
